Antibiotic-mixed collagen-synthetic polymer composite material as an antibacterial biomedical material

Abstract
We previously described a new method of producing antibacterial biomedical materials by the immobilization of lysozyme and a polypeptide antibiotic Polymyxin B onto the surface of collagen-synthetic polymer composite material. We have developed another method of producing antibacterial biomedical materials by mixing broad spectrum antibiotics, Cephalexin and Tobramycin, with the collagen membrane layer of collagen-synthetic polymer composite material. This antibiotic-mixed composite material showed excellent antibacterial activity against Staphylococcus aureus. The elution rate of antibiotics from the collagen membrane layer can be controlled considerably by glutaraldehyde cross-linking treatment of the collagen. This antibiotic-mixed composite material adapted better to the rabbit's dorsal subcutaneous tissue in the earlier stage of implantation than composite material without mixed antibiotic.
